I'll offer two great defenders:

Chelsea Terry of James Island would have to be on anyone's short list of best defenders in the state. She's athletic with both strength and speed and her first touch is great. She can also be brought up to offense if needed.

Danielle Jordan (West Ashley) is in a class by herself. She is an olympic quality athlete who also plays great basketball. Her speed, especially instant acceleration, is probably the best in the state and she controls the ball with her feet with more skill than most of control our hands. She's a southpaw and can shoot wickedly if up front. As long as she stays fully motivated and dedicated to this game she can move up from HS to college to olympic/pro. A joy to watch.

I must add the disclaimer that I am her coach and am therefore somewhat biased, but I must add Malia Pack from Lakewood on this list. She is a senior and for the past two or three years, she has been the backbone of our defense. We haven't had much success in the win column and the scores against us have been rather misleading, but one player can't stop them all. She is a bulldog on the field. Short, but full of drive. She'll run anyone off the ball and is willing to completely sacrifice her body to stop the play if at all possible. Anyone who has watched her play can attest to everything I've said. I 've seen star players from top-notch teams almost get sent off of the field because she frustrates them so much. Even the refs come over to shake her hand and compliment her on how well she has played. Of course I'm biased, but I believe her name should be up here with the best defenders in the state.
